Midway Sailor Posted December 31, 2012 Share Posted December 31, 2012 (edited) TA-7C Corsair II ~ Bu. No. 154500 American Wings Air Museum, Blaine, MN As featured in the 1/48 HobbyBoss TA-7C Corsair II kit #80346: 388 walkaround photos on my site: TA-7C Corsair II Bu. No. 154500 from the American Wings Air Museum in Blaine, MN taken from May 2003 ~ May 2005 (120 photos) TA-7C Corsair II Bu. No. 154500 from the American Wings Air Museum in Blaine, MN taken on July 16, 2011 (268 photos) The second gallery is especially helpful to anyone detail modeling a "Twosair" because I opened most of the panels to take photos. Surprisingly, a lot of the equipment was still intact.
